Siouxsie Sioux | live Cruel World Festival makeup show, May 21, 2023 Pasadena / Los Angeles Cruel World Fest was cut short and evacuated on May 20, 2023, because of an impending lightning storm and this makeup show was held the next evening
Hide player controls
Hide resume playing